What it does

The basic premise is a dating site filtering potential matches based on your interests, your location and personal preferences. What is unique about our site is the focus on audio message as a first impression instead of the picture format, to make it more accessible towards sight impaired people. Additionally, there is a functional chat app built into our site when two people match. Finally, we have also tried to add informing alt texts on the site to help people with sight impairment navigate everything with ease.

Challenges we ran into

The whole project can be considered challenging because managing what each member does and how it might affect others contributions when merging was a constant struggle. The parts that took us most time were most likely distance based filtering and location integration because of a API we never used before. What's more is the backend of chat communication which had to be redone at least two times because of not working as intended. Last but not least, is the visual and functional aspect of the site, which proved to be a tough nut to crack. Luckily we overcame most obstacles with a functional product
